Form 4: ChargePoint Executive Receives RSU Grant

Sentiment:

Statement of Changes in Beneficial Ownership


ChargePoint Holdings, Inc. CCXO Jagdeep Singh was granted 75,000 restricted stock units subject to a three-year vesting schedule.

Summary

  • Jagdeep Singh, Chief Commercial Officer (CCXO) of ChargePoint Holdings, Inc., was awarded 75,000 restricted stock units (RSUs).
  • The grant represents a contingent right to receive one share of common stock per RSU.
  • The award is subject to a service-based vesting schedule spanning three years starting June 1, 2026.
  • Vesting begins with 1/12th of the units on June 20, 2026, followed by equal quarterly installments.
